diff options
author | Jakub Jelinek <jakub@redhat.com> | 2012-11-29 09:32:32 +0100 |
---|---|---|
committer | Jakub Jelinek <jakub@gcc.gnu.org> | 2012-11-29 09:32:32 +0100 |
commit | 2bc462ea547599dfa89c09075047bd27c76f576a (patch) | |
tree | a1c55e2b62122e1f8c3844a7c2c461e83518c18d /gcc | |
parent | bfe7af891c74a374bbc399a9f1f45863f4bd92eb (diff) | |
download | gcc-2bc462ea547599dfa89c09075047bd27c76f576a.zip gcc-2bc462ea547599dfa89c09075047bd27c76f576a.tar.gz gcc-2bc462ea547599dfa89c09075047bd27c76f576a.tar.bz2 |
re PR rtl-optimization/55512 (Various LRA ICEs with inline-asm)
PR rtl-optimization/55512
* gcc.target/i386/pr55512-2.c: Remove unnecessary define.
* gcc.target/i386/pr55512-4.c: Likewise.
From-SVN: r193923
Diffstat (limited to 'gcc')
-rw-r--r-- | gcc/testsuite/ChangeLog | 6 | ||||
-rw-r--r-- | gcc/testsuite/gcc.target/i386/pr55512-2.c | 3 | ||||
-rw-r--r-- | gcc/testsuite/gcc.target/i386/pr55512-4.c | 3 |
3 files changed, 6 insertions, 6 deletions
di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og index cea4e76..ad8880a 100644 --- a/gcc/testsuite/ChangeLog +++ b/gcc/testsuite/ChangeLog @@ -1,3 +1,9 @@ +2012-11-29 Jakub Jelinek <jakub@redhat.com> + + PR rtl-optimization/55512 + * gcc.target/i386/pr55512-2.c: Remove unnecessary define. + * gcc.target/i386/pr55512-4.c: Likewise. + 2012-11-29 Ed Smith-Rowland <3dw4rd@verizon.net> PR c++/52654 diff --git a/gcc/testsuite/gcc.target/i386/pr55512-2.c b/gcc/testsuite/gcc.target/i386/pr55512-2.c index eec2a88..114710c 100644 --- a/gcc/testsuite/gcc.target/i386/pr55512-2.c +++ b/gcc/testsuite/gcc.target/i386/pr55512-2.c @@ -1,8 +1,6 @@ /* { dg-do compile } */ /* { dg-options "-O2" } */ -#define __builtin_unreachable() do { } while (0) - int foo (int x) { @@ -10,7 +8,6 @@ foo (int x) "r" (x + 4), "r" (x + 5), "r" (x + 6), "r" (x + 7), "r" (x + 8), "r" (x + 9), "r" (x + 10), "r" (x + 11), "r" (x + 12), "r" (x + 13), "r" (x + 14), "r" (x + 15) : : lab); - __builtin_unreachable (); lab: return 0; } diff --git a/gcc/testsuite/gcc.target/i386/pr55512-4.c b/gcc/testsuite/gcc.target/i386/pr55512-4.c index 3fcd11c..250243a 100644 --- a/gcc/testsuite/gcc.target/i386/pr55512-4.c +++ b/gcc/testsuite/gcc.target/i386/pr55512-4.c @@ -1,8 +1,6 @@ /* { dg-do compile } */ /* { dg-options "-O2" } */ -#define __builtin_unreachable() do { } while (0) - int bar (int x) { @@ -11,7 +9,6 @@ bar (int x) "r" (x + 8), "r" (x + 9), "r" (x + 10), "r" (x + 11), "r" (x + 12), "r" (x + 13), "r" (x + 14), "r" (x + 15), "r" (x + 16) : : lab); - __builtin_unreachable (); lab: return 0; } |